Each build runs inside an ephemeral, network-isolated executor; the dependency lockfile, compiler version, and rule-schema revision are recorded in a signed attestation. Plugin authors should validate their extensions against the attested schema revision rather than the marketing version string. The trace token identifying the exact build you are running appears immediately below.

session token of tajef-bageg = htk21_5d90d574934f3ccae6437

Handover Note — Closure of the Drayford Office

For the board: the Drayford site closure is on schedule for end of quarter. Seven staff have accepted transfers to Millbrook; two redundancies are in consultation. Lease termination terms are agreed, with a modest break fee. Incoming director assumes oversight of final asset disposal. A confidential note regarding related plans appears below.

management briefing: Project Ulavan slips by two quarters because of the staffing delay.

## Authentication

As discussed at last week's sync, the Quellhaven auth gateway intermittently fails DNS resolution for the token-issuer endpoint, causing spurious 401s in Brightmere staging. We've confirmed the resolver cache in the sidecar expires faster than the upstream TTL, so retries within two seconds usually succeed. Until the resolver patch lands, clients should pin the issuer host and authenticate directly against the Quellhaven internal API using the key below.

service key, yadug-bajog: zpat3_pou